BERNS STEVEN sold $45K of TW

BERNS STEVEN sold 425 shares of Tradeweb Markets Inc. (TW) at $105.26 on 2026-05-26 under a Rule 10b5-1 trading plan.

What Happened? Shares of electronic trading platform Tradeweb Markets (NASDAQ: TW) fell 9.9% in the afternoon session after the electronic trading platform operator reported second-quarter results that failed to meet high investor expectations. The company posted an adjusted earnings per share of $0.97, which beat Wall Street's consensus estimate of $0.95. However, its revenue of $558.9 million was just shy of the $559.2 million forecast.
